Kindred Connections Counseling PLLC is a working clinical practice and a training site. Graduate students in practicum and internship placements see real clients here, under close supervision, as part of how we grow the next generation of culturally responsive counselors.

For Clients & Referral Sources

Services Our Interns Provide

Clients who work with a Kindred intern receive the same culturally responsive, person-centered care as anyone else in the practice — delivered by a developing clinician whose work is directly overseen by a licensed supervisor at every step.

What an intern can offer

  • Individual counseling, under direct clinical supervision
  • Intake sessions, assessment, and collaborative treatment planning
  • Co-facilitation of groups alongside a licensed clinician
  • Consistent, timely clinical documentation, reviewed as part of supervision
  • Telehealth sessions using the same secure platform as the rest of the practice
🌱
Why this can be a good fit

Working with a supervised intern often means more availability and a clinician who brings real energy to the work, backed by a supervisor reviewing the case. It's a genuine, well-supported level of care — not a lesser version of it.

For Students & Academic Programs

How We Train Our Interns

Every intern at Kindred is clinically assessed before placement, receives ongoing training throughout their time with us, and works under close clinical supervision. Training and support don't stop once you start seeing clients — they continue for as long as you're here.
